Abstract

Constant-frequency contours analysis method and the plane-wave method were employed to gain the frequency range of the incident electromagnetic waves when all-angle negative refraction (AANR) phenomenon occurs in two-dimensional photonic crystals. The dependence of the frequency range on structural parameter (crystal lattice shape, the ratio of the rod radius and the lattice constant) and electromagnetic parameter (the dielectric constants of the rods and of the background, incident electromagnetic waves with different polarization) were investigated. The result shows that when a dielectric constant is fixed, it is necessary that the other dielectric constant reach a threshold. Photonic crystal has its optimized structural parameter and electromagnetic parameter when it has its largest AANR frequency range.
